Output 8b429dbceef94b7d79220401369dc70bd6ac4b3115229e67a2180ee3a3961e29:2

value
780618
script pubkey
OP_0 OP_PUSHBYTES_20 36f68d57d06124e8205a507cd779c296afdfc283
address
tb1qxmmg647svyjwsgz62p7dw7wzj6hals5rtzefhn
transaction
8b429dbceef94b7d79220401369dc70bd6ac4b3115229e67a2180ee3a3961e29
confirmations
101561
spent
true